Output 5875c24543eecb3d6b68a5cc326f08426c3585539e8fc5242b63628941079f81:10

value
333578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94f7dc40bcba798157e9db8d17fb869c5efaf1de OP_EQUAL
address
3FGgraH93txZPs7hHmAcbrqW7ZS79sFngW
transaction
5875c24543eecb3d6b68a5cc326f08426c3585539e8fc5242b63628941079f81
spent
true